Where Nature Does the Teaching and Confidence Follows
I love books. I believe in education.
But some of the most powerful things I’ve ever seen a child learn didn’t happen at a desk — they happened outside.
They happened while leading a horse.
While figuring out how to stand up on a paddleboard.
While sitting in silence, noticing the sky and their own heartbeat.
And research backs it up: children learn better, regulate emotions more effectively, and build lasting confidence when they’re outside.

Sustainable Ranching at MeadowView Reins
At MeadowView Reins, we embrace rotational grazing to promote healthier pastures, stronger soil, and thriving sheep—all while honoring God’s design for the land. This sustainable ranching practice enhances soil fertility, reduces erosion, and even helps combat climate change. Join us in creating a more resilient, intentional way of living.
